Subject: [PATCH net] MAINTAINERS: trim the GVE entry

We requested in the past that GVE patches coming out of Google should
be submitted only by GVE maintainers. There were too many patches
posted which didn't follow the subsystem guidance.

Recently Joshua was added to maintainers, but even tho he was asked
to follow the netdev "FAQ" in the past [1] he still does not follow
the trivial rules. It is not reasonable for a person who hasn't read
the maintainer entry for the subsystem to be a driver maintainer.
